The Challenge: Why Traditional Estimation Methods Fall Short
Before exploring the capabilities of AI-powered quoting, it's important to understand the limitations of traditional approaches:
- Time consumption - Manual takeoffs and calculations often require hours per quote
- Inconsistency - Different estimators may produce widely varying quotes for identical projects
- Limited complexity modeling - Basic spreadsheets struggle to account for all variables affecting job difficulty
- Fixed pricing models - Traditional systems lack the flexibility to adjust for shop capacity and market conditions
- Disconnected workflows - Estimation is often isolated from other business systems, creating data silos
These limitations result in quotes that either leave money on the table or price fabricators out of competitive jobs.

3. Comprehensive Complexity Analysis
Perhaps the most powerful aspect of the AI system is its ability to assess job complexity:
- Sophisticated algorithms analyze design complexity beyond basic measurements
- Each cutout is evaluated based on type, size, location, and fabrication difficulty
- Edge details are scored based on both length and complexity factors
- Special features like waterfall edges, book matching, and integrated features are identified and costed
- Installation complexity factors including access issues and special requirements are considered
This nuanced complexity assessment ensures jobs are priced according to their true production requirements.
4. Dynamic Pricing Based on Shop Capacity
Unlike static pricing systems, our AI quoting tool:
- Integrates with production scheduling to understand current shop capacity
- Applies configurable margin adjustments based on capacity utilization
- Differentiates between different work types when assessing available capacity
- Provides optional rush pricing for expedited projects
This ensures optimal pricing that maximizes both shop utilization and profitability.
